Output 51c88f80d4b23d247462c184a4414f06f61cb4bce9834d2e5ac8453c0a28d9dd:1

value
4501819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4c203d83fba32027a956904976222e45ea03b11 OP_EQUAL
address
3M5ybcRiSxkDQLjrWx79dKGLYuefYtfXH4
transaction
51c88f80d4b23d247462c184a4414f06f61cb4bce9834d2e5ac8453c0a28d9dd
spent
true